Keep Up With Routine Maintenance
Staying current with scheduled maintenance offers a simple way to maximize fuel efficiency. Dirty air filters, old spark plugs, and low tire pressure quietly reduce fuel economy over time. Following the maintenance schedule in the owner’s manual keeps the engine running at its best. Fresh oil, properly inflated tires, and clean filters give the powertrain less resistance on every drive.
Watch How You Drive
Driving habits significantly impact fuel use. Aggressive acceleration and hard braking burn fuel quickly. Accelerate gradually and coast to a stop when traffic allows. Maintaining a steady highway speed instead of constantly speeding up and slowing down makes a noticeable difference. Available Ford Co-Pilot360 technology features like adaptive cruise control help drivers hold a consistent pace.
Reduce Unnecessary Weight and Drag
Carrying extra weight in a truck bed or cargo area forces the engine to work harder. Remove tools and gear you do not regularly use. Roof racks and cargo carriers create wind resistance. Taking them off when not in use improves aerodynamics. These small changes add up for drivers sitting in stop-and-go traffic.
Use Technology Wisely
Modern Ford models include tools to help you drive smarter. Connected navigation finds the most efficient routes to your destination. Using the trip computer or the FordPass app to monitor real-time fuel consumption helps you understand your driving patterns and make necessary adjustments.
